Crisis UK is seeking a Reception/Administrator for the Skylight Centre in Liverpool. In this role, you will be the first point of contact for individuals seeking support, ensuring a welcoming environment. You will manage reception responsibilities and provide administrative support to help those at risk of homelessness.
The ideal candidate will have experience in customer service and working with vulnerable groups, ensuring high-quality assistance is provided.
Employee benefits include a competitive salary, interest-free loans, and enhanced leave policies.
